Attributes in Mechanical 6 Titleblock

Hi

Does anyone have an explanation of the numbers that appear at the end of the
attribute definitions in the standard title blocks. I believe they control
the length of the string when the attribute is in use. I am talking about
the numbers in the curly braces something like gen-part-name{5.92}.

the number represents a ratio for fit of a line into a space..... for
example if you have .25 height text and a 5" space to fit it into.... your
number would be 20.0 ( 5/.25) if it were .14 high and a 3.45
space....24.64... (3.45/.14)
